At present, traditional design is facing challenges, and AI brings new opportunities to the design field. This article focuses on the application of AI (Artificial Intelligence) visual expression characteristics in modern design. Firstly, this article analyzes the characteristics of precision, efficiency and innovation of AI visual expression, expounds the requirements of modern design in various fields, and then explains in detail the specific applications in plane, product, interior and other designs. In this article, an algorithm model based on the combination of GAN (Generative Adversarial Network) and CNN (Convolutional Neural Network) is adopted. Training and testing on a data set covering 10000 images. The experimental results show that the SSIM (Structural Similarity Index) of the generated image is stable at about 0.8 after 50 rounds of training, and the display of the generated image hash distance is highly innovative, and it takes only 10 minutes to generate 100 design images on average, which is much faster than the traditional design method. The research shows that the algorithm model can effectively improve the application efficiency of AI in modern design and provide strong support for the innovation and development of modern design.
